Development of a Website, Smart Contract, and DAPP for the Worldwide Token

Main Requirements:

  • Development of a token website for convenient and informative interaction with current and future users.
  • Smart contract development for the token on the Binance Smart Chain (BSC).
  • Development of a decentralized web application (DAPP).

Our team was tasked with creating three products to implement a blockchain business model. We needed to build a platform for crypto enthusiasts to earn not only the Worldwide token but also additional popular tokens like Ethereum, BNB, Bitcoin, and others.

Firstly, we focused on creating a website to inform existing users and attract new ones. We designed the website based on the client's input, including the logo they provided and the style gathered from interviews and examples of preferred websites. The resulting single-page website covers information about the Worldwide token, its founders, how it works, the roadmap, token economics, and special features.

Simultaneously, we worked on developing the smart contract for the token and creating a decentralized application (DAPP).

Token Specifications:

  • Blockchain: Binance Smart Chain (BSC)
  • Token Ticker: WORLD
  • Maximum Token Supply: 10,000,000 WORLD
  • APY: 77% per annum
  • Rebase Schedule: $World undergoes rebases every 15 minutes automatically.
  • Burn function.
  • Not mintable.

In the contract, we implemented taxes on token purchase, sale, and transfer. We also included a Rebase function where token holders receive 0.1566% profit from their token amount every day, with calculations occurring every 15 minutes, utilizing a compound interest formula. Additionally, we formulated tax distribution for buy, sell, and transfer transactions.

Tax Distribution:

BUY

  • 10% tax on buy transactions.
  • 70% to Treasury
  • 15% to The World Pool
  • 15% Vaporized Automatically

SELL

  • 10% tax on sell transactions.
  • 70% to Treasury
  • 15% to The World Pool
  • 15% Vaporized Automatically

TRANSFER

  • 2% transfer tax in $World.
  • 1% sent to Treasury (in $BNB)
  • 1% allocated to the World Pool (in $WORLD)

As part of the tax, various pools collect funds. One of them is the World Pool, from which each token holder receives a percentage based on their token holdings relative to the total World token value held by all holders. This additional reward can be claimed once a day.

We also implemented a referral system where a participant receives 0.5% of all operations conducted by the person they referred.

In addition, the contract includes what are known as WWEvents. Participation in the giveaways of other coins can be on a paid or free basis, with the reward calculation algorithm being similar to the one described above. The combination of all these activities creates additional value and provides the project with a steady income for development.

The third stage of project development involved creating a decentralized application (DAPP). Here, token holders can manage their assets and create additional monetization opportunities. They can claim their Rebase every 15 minutes, make a daily claim in World, and participate in and collect rewards in Events.

The design of the DAPP was executed in the style of the main website. The goal was to log in users, and we needed to determine if they have the World token in their wallets. Since we are on the Binance Smart Chain, we decided to integrate MetaMask for user wallet recognition.

We integrated it in a way that allowed us to see the balance of our token for each participant. For transparency, token owners could not only see their Rebase and Claim balances but also the token amounts in the pools from the previous day and the accumulated amounts for the current day.

Everything was thoroughly tested on the BSC Testnet several times, but it didn't prevent us from encountering issues later on.

To launch the product successfully, we needed a solid partner, and for startup launches, we chose Pink Sale. We launched twice on this platform. In the first launch, the client set a high entry point, aiming to sell their tokens in the range of a minimum of 750 to a maximum of 1500 BNB, equivalent to approximately $165,000 to $330,000. The token price was set at $7. Initially, things went well, raising around $120,000 in the first 5 hours. However, sales halted, and we canceled the launch to restart. People received their funds back. For the second attempt, we decided to reduce everything by 10 times, lowering the token price to $0.7. The minimum sale amount was $15,000, and the maximum was $30,000.

We chose these entry thresholds based on the trust we observed from the community, approximately $120,000. Our logic was that by selling $30,000, we would have around $80,000 remaining from people interested in purchasing the product on the exchange with a currency pair, which turned out to be beneficial for us. After the relaunch, sales closed in 7 seconds, selling $30,000 worth of World tokens. This set a record on Pink Sale for token sales.

Everything started working, and we launched the BNB to World trading pair with a maximum price of $3. At that time, the liquidity pool was $15,000, and within the first week, the pool balance almost doubled, indicating the correctness of our steps.

We launched, tested, processed support tickets, and onboarded new users who joined our Discord, which was well-organized by the client, including support tickets. We processed numerous questions since the product, user flow, and business model were new, and many users didn't fully understand them. Users needed clarification on aspects like claiming and rebasing since it was a new approach in the market.

Later on, we faced the challenge of attracting new holders. To address this, we decided to revamp the website to appeal to a new audience showing interest in the token due to the founders' marketing efforts. At this stage, we added more information about the product and earnings opportunities, along with statistical data on the monetary equivalent of earnings for active token holders.

In the course of events, we encountered a major issue that we didn't notice during development. In the whitepaper, the transaction tax was supposed to be - 10% for buy and sell, and 2% for transfer. During development, many algorithms related to each other were implemented, resulting in a buy tax of only 4.6%. This was a significant problem as, during the first week, there was a large volume of purchases, and we lost a substantial amount. To address this, we raised the sell tax to 15.4%, intending to balance the situation. However, users were reluctant to sell because they realized they could earn not only on the World token but also on other tokens in events, such as Ethereum, BNB, Bitcoin, and more.

This led to the next challenge: how to redeploy the contract when, according to the terms of collaboration with Pink Sale, we couldn't access the liquidity pool for 12 months from the launch date. This was a critical issue because, without access, we couldn't do anything. The decision was made to inform all token holders, around 500 people at that time, that we wanted to buy back our liquidity pool by selling a large amount of tokens at once. In 1 second, we bought back 80-85% of the entire liquidity, around $24,000. On the same day, we deployed the second version of the contract and refilled the liquidity that we bought back, maintaining the same price. We informed Pancake Swap, the platform where the token is traded, about these changes. We took a snapshot of all token holders beforehand, dropped all their tokens to zero at the new contract address after deployment.

In conclusion, having traversed a complex yet fascinating development path, we rectified mistakes, and now everything works correctly. This project is a living entity that functions, evolves, and attracts new users. The founders continue to develop new visions for the project's growth, support, and earning opportunities. Our team, on its part, continues to implement the technical aspects of the project's development.
